Understanding California's Construction Laws: What Homeowners Need to Know

Navigating California’s construction laws can feel overwhelming, especially for homeowners planning a renovation, demolition, or new construction project. From permits to safety regulations, understanding the essentials is crucial to ensuring your project complies with the law and avoids unnecessary fines or delays.

Key Construction Laws in California

  1. Permits and Approvals
    Most construction projects require permits, whether it’s a small remodel or a complete demolition. Local building departments enforce these requirements to ensure safety and code compliance.

  2. SB721 Balcony Inspection Law
    California’s SB721 law mandates periodic inspections of balconies and decks in multi-family residential buildings. This regulation aims to prevent structural failures and ensure safety for occupants.

  3. Licensing Requirements for Contractors
    Always ensure your contractor holds a valid California State License. Licensed professionals adhere to strict standards, protecting you from liability and substandard work.

  4. Environmental Regulations
    Projects involving demolition or excavation often need to comply with environmental standards, including proper disposal of hazardous materials and adherence to air quality rules.

  5. Zoning and Property Line Laws
    Construction projects must align with zoning regulations and respect property boundaries. Violations can lead to legal disputes and costly adjustments.
